Airport Remarks
- ESTABD PRIOR TO 15 MAY 1959.
- TWY LGTS ON TWY W, A, L, AND B.
- AIRPORT FIELD CONDITIONS UNMONITORED 1700 LCL - 0700 LCL.
- EMERG FREQ 121.5 NOT MNT AT TWR.
- FOR CD WHEN ATCT IS CLSD CTC SEATTLE APCH AT 206-214-4723.
- WHEN ATCT CLSD ACTVT HIRL RY 17/35; MALSR 17; REIL RY 35, TWY LGTS & DIRECTIONAL SIGNAGE - CTAF. PAPI RYS 17 & 35 OPER CONT.
- SFC COND IRREG AND UNEVEN.

KOLM Operational Overview
Location & Facility
OLYMPIA RGNL (KOLM) is a publicly owned airport open to the public located in OLYMPIA, Washington, United States. The field sits at an elevation of 207.8 feet above mean sea level (MSL) at coordinates 46.9694°N, 122.9025°W.
